10 TIPS FOR BUYING BAGS

 

Before choosing the new bag, you should ask yourself the following questions:

What should the bag be able to do?

Before you buy, think about when and where you want to carry the bag. Should it be a model for university, leisure, office or rather for parties? Does the bag have to fulfil practical aspects, or should it be a trendy bag that attracts attention?

Which bag suits my style?

It is important that the bag matches your own style. Whether sporty, trendy or classic - your style should also be reflected here. There are classic bag shapes such as the handle bag, the shopper or the shoulder bag, but also modern shapes such as the pouch bag with drawstring. Maybe the hip trend of the belt bag would be something for you? Decide for yourself what suits you!

What material should the bag have?

Whether leather bag, fabric bag, recycling bag or vegan bag, there is a huge selection of bags. First, ask yourself the following questions: How important is the material to me? Do certain materials suit me and my lifestyle better? Also note, for example, that leather needs to be cared for and is a little more sensitive than a cloth bag. In addition to your own requirements, the purpose for which the bag is to be used, your own style certainly also plays a role.

How much money do I want to spend?

Do you have a fixed budget for the new bag? Certain materials could be mutually exclusive here. A bag made of fine cowhide, for example, is more expensive than a bag made of canvas, nylon or polyester. With an asking price in mind, you can narrow down the selection a bit.

How big does the bag have to be?

Think about what everything has to be with you. Should A4 documents fit in the pocket or is it more about smaller everyday items such as wallet, smartphone, handkerchiefs and the like? What do I absolutely need, and what can I do without? From bags in XS to XXL, there is everything to choose from.

Does the bag fit my height?

Apart from the things that have to be carried in the bag every day, the bag size should be selected proportionally to the body size so that the overall picture is correct. Even if XL formats are trendy, a small woman should rather fall back on a small to medium size bag. It also saves your back.

How do I wear it?

A bag can be carried in the crook of the arm, on the shoulder or as a shoulder bag. However, many handbags are real quick-change artists: thanks to the shoulder strap supplied, the handbag can also be used practically as a shoulder bag. Just think about which variant you prefer for your new bag.

Am I the type for many small subjects or a major?

In addition to a large main compartment, a bag can have many inner compartments, small slip-in or zip-up compartments or attached front pockets. Depending on your preferences, this can be very helpful. Maybe a key loop is also extremely important to you? Then be sure to pay attention to it when buying.

Do I also need certain functions?

Does your new bag have to have certain functions? Starting with a trolley slip-on function, a separate rain cover, adjustable waist belt and a padded laptop compartment, a bag can do a lot. You should only be aware of the wishes you have for your new darling before buying.

What is my gut feeling?

In the end, you should listen to your gut feeling. If you like a bag and at least most of the wishes and requirements for a bag are met, then you should buy it. Sometimes love at first sight counts here too ...
